首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

MSSQL 2008合并具有分组的连续日期

MSSQL 2008是Microsoft SQL Server 2008的简称,它是一种关系型数据库管理系统(RDBMS),由Microsoft开发和提供支持。MSSQL 2008具有合并具有分组的连续日期的功能,以下是对该功能的完善和全面的答案:

概念:

MSSQL 2008中的合并具有分组的连续日期是指将具有相同连续日期的数据行合并为一个分组。这个功能可以用于数据分析和报表生成等场景,以便更好地理解和展示数据。

分类:

合并具有分组的连续日期是MSSQL 2008中的数据处理操作,属于数据聚合和分组的一种。

优势:

  1. 数据整理:合并具有分组的连续日期可以将具有相同连续日期的数据行合并为一个分组,使数据更加整洁和易于分析。
  2. 数据分析:通过合并具有分组的连续日期,可以更好地进行数据分析,例如计算每个日期范围内的总和、平均值、最大值、最小值等统计指标。
  3. 报表生成:合并具有分组的连续日期可以用于生成报表,以便更好地展示数据趋势和变化。

应用场景:

合并具有分组的连续日期在许多领域都有应用,例如:

  1. 销售分析:可以将每日销售数据按照日期范围进行合并,以便分析每个日期范围内的销售情况。
  2. 财务报表:可以将每月财务数据按照月份进行合并,以便生成月度财务报表。
  3. 用户活跃度分析:可以将用户活跃度数据按照日期范围进行合并,以便分析每个日期范围内的用户活跃度。

推荐的腾讯云相关产品:

腾讯云提供了多种与数据库相关的产品和服务,以下是一些推荐的产品:

  1. 云数据库SQL Server:腾讯云的托管式SQL Server数据库服务,提供高可用性、高性能和高安全性的数据库解决方案。
  2. 云数据库TDSQL:腾讯云的分布式关系型数据库服务,支持SQL Server和MySQL,适用于大规模数据存储和高并发访问场景。
  3. 云数据库CynosDB:腾讯云的分布式数据库服务,支持MySQL和PostgreSQL,适用于大规模数据存储和高性能计算场景。

产品介绍链接地址:

  1. 云数据库SQL Server:https://cloud.tencent.com/product/cdb_sqlserver
  2. 云数据库TDSQL:https://cloud.tencent.com/product/tdsql
  3. 云数据库CynosDB:https://cloud.tencent.com/product/cynosdb

请注意,以上推荐的腾讯云产品仅供参考,具体选择应根据实际需求和情况进行评估和决策。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

【翻译】SQL Server 30 年历史

标准版:该版本是具有核心功能基本选项。专业版:该版本具有OLAP立方体等附加功能。企业版:这是针对拥有大型数据库系统大型企业最高级版本。...SQL Server 6.5发行日期: 1996 年 6 月SQL Server 6.5 新功能如下:支持互联网应分销交易有所改善异构复制SQL Server 7.0发行日期: 1998 年 11 月这个新版本具有以下新功能...SQL Server 2008发行日期2008 年 8 月这个版本附带了透明数据加密SQL Server审计数据压缩PowerShell 支持有关更改列表,请参阅以下链接: SQL Server 2008...SQL Server 2008 R2发布日期:2010 年 4 月该版本引入了以下内容:数据中心版并行数据仓库版主数据服务SQL Server 2012发布日期:2012 年 3 月该版本具有以下功能:...合并了 新 DAX 函数。主数据服务 (MDS) 包括支持 多对多层次结构和 基于域属性过滤等功能。此外,它还包括 使用变更集 实体同步和 审批工作流程。 重新设计了业务规则管理。

28600
  • 六、CPU优化(3)处理器组

    标识启动日志文件名和存储位置。一般为C:\Program Files\Microsoft SQL Server\MSSQL11.MSSQLSERVER\MSSQL\Log\ERRORLOG 。   ...逻辑CPU    在购买SQL Server 2008 正版时,标准版和企业版都有一种Per Processor 授权方式,这里Processor 只是针对物理CPU,与核(core)数量没有关系。...这样导致每次启动Windows时,都可能会得到不一样分组情况,可能是60+20分配,也可能是40+40分配。   ...SQL Server 修复   在Windows ver6.1之后发布 SQL Server 2008 R2 解决了这个问题,但SQL Server 2008 R2 最多只能检测到256个逻辑CPU。...本文结语:   SQL Server 2008 for Windows Server 2008 在遇到超过64个逻辑CPU时需要注意这个问题。

    99930

    MySQL 8.0 新增SQL语法对窗口函数和CTE支持

    通过一个case来体验一下窗口函数方便性,熟悉MSSQL或者Oracle或者PostgreSQL老司机就不用看了。   ...当然也可以不分组,对整体进行排序。...任何一个窗口函数,都可以分组统计或者不分组统计(也即可以不要partition by ***都可以,看你需求了) rank()   类似于 row_number(),也是排序功能,但是rank()有什么不一样...这里不做细节演示,仅演示一种递归用法,用递归方式生成连续日期。   当然递归不会无限下去,不同数据库有不同递归限制,MySQL 8.0中默认限制最大递归次数是1000。   ...关于CTE限制,跟其他数据库并无太大差异,比如CTE内部查询结果都要有字段名称,不允许连续对一个CTE多次查询等等,相信熟悉CTE老司机都很清楚。

    2.2K20

    MSSQL 2014 TDE透明加密使用

    create_datedatetime显示创建加密密钥日期(UTC)。regenerate_datedatetime显示重新生成加密密钥日期(UTC)。...modify_datedatetime显示已修改加密密钥日期(以 UTC 为单位)。set_datedatetime显示加密密钥应用于数据库日期(以 UTC 为单位)。...N'/var/opt/mssql/data/TSQL2008Copy.mdf', MOVE 'TSQL2008_Log' TO N'/var/opt/mssql/data/TSQL2008Copy.ldf...然后,看下tempdb加密状态,如果还是加密,需要重启下mssql进程。...最后,你必须立即对你未加密数据库进行全面备份,以确保你有一个没有任何密钥或证书健康备份。TDE对性能影响这这里我没有自己测试,看是网上基于mssql2008测试报告。具体仅供参考。

    11510

    Excel常用函数

    尝试查找月份日期应使用 DATE 函数输入日期,或者将日期作为其他公式或函数结果输入。 例如,使用函数 DATE(2008,5,23) 输入 2008 年 5 月 23 日。...用法 日期 2008-7-5 2010-7-5 公式 描述(结果) 结果 =YEAR(A3) 单元格 A3 中日期年份 (2008) 2008 =YEAR(A4) 单元格 A4 中日期年份...1(星期一)到 7(星期日)表示一周中第几天 (4) 4 =WEEKDAY(A2, 3) 使用数字 0(星期一)到 6(星期日)表示一周中第几天 (3) 3 18、日期函数 DATE() 返回表示特定日期连续序列号...注意: Excel 可将日期存储为连续序列号,以便能在计算中使用它们。...用法 =DATE(C2,A2,B2) 将单元格 C2 中年、单元格 A2 中月以及单元格 B2 中合并在一起,并将它们放入一个单元格内作为日期。 =DATE(C2,A2,B2)

    3.6K40

    MSSQL2008技术内幕:T-SQL语言基础》读书笔记(下)

    5.2 逆透视   所谓逆透视(Unpivoting)转换是一种把数据从列状态旋转为行状态技术,它将来自单个记录中多个列值扩展为单个列中具有相同值得多个记录。...SQL Server 2008中引入了一个GROUPING_ID函数,简化了关联结果行和分组处理,可以容易地计算出每一行和哪个分组集相关联。   ...@nextval; 6.2.2 新玩法:合并数据   SQL Server 2008引入了一个叫做MERGE语句,它能在一条语句中根据逻辑条件对数据进行不同修改操作(INSERT/UPDATE/DELETE...下面来看看一个实例,它使用游标来计算CustOrders视图中每个客户每个月连续总订货量(连续聚合案例): -- Example: Running Aggregations SET NOCOUNT ON...下面的示例创建了一个用户定义函数dbo.fn_age,对于给定出生日期和事件日期,这个函数可以返回某个人在时间日期当时年龄: IF OBJECT_ID('dbo.fn_age') IS NOT NULL

    8.9K20

    一文搞懂连续问题

    面试题目是不能这样出,因为这样描述起来太过复杂,很难描述清楚,并且描述完成之后基本就给出了答案,所以题目往往是要求求取连续之后聚合信息,例如:查询最大连续天数、合并连续数据、查询连续超过N用户等等...(具体是什么日期无所谓,只是以一个固定日期为锚点)差得到排序值1(date_diff),然后使用row_number()函数根据用户分组,按照登陆日期进行排序得到排序值2(row_num),然后用两个排序值做差...百度大数据面试SQL-合并用户浏览行为该题目先是对连续条件增加要求,要求与上一行数据时间差小于60S,得到连续分组ID 之后将数据进行合并处理。...京东大数据面试SQL-合并数据该题目属于在得到分组ID之后,增加了数据进行拼接聚合要求。高难度连续问题1....在得到连续分组ID之后 需要计算出连续登陆最早和最晚日期,然后差值计算,还需要考虑到差值与登陆天数差天细节。总结通过以上面试题目可以看出,只要找到连续分组ID,所以题目都可以迎刃而解。

    4800

    mysql和sqlserver区别_一定和必须区别

    一个很表面的区别就是mysql安装特别简单,而且文件大小才110M(非安装版),相比微软这个庞然大物,安装进度来说简直就是… mysql管理工具有几个比较好,mysql_front,和官方那个套件...php连接mysql和mssql方式都差不多,只需要将函数mysql替换成mssql即可。 mysql支持date,time,year类型,mssql2008才支持date和time。...却是 `,也就是按键1左边那个符号 mssql支持getdate()方法获取当前时间日期,但是mysql里面可以分日期类型和时间类型,获取当前日期是cur_date(),当前完整时间是now()函数...20一个很表面的区别就是mysql安装特别简单,而且文件大小才110M(非安装版),相比微软这个庞然大物,安装进度来说简直就是… 21mysql管理工具有几个比较好,mysql_front,和官方那个套件...25mysql支持date,time,year类型,mssql2008才支持date和time。 MySQL 数值数据类型可以大致划分为两个类别,一个是整数,另一个是浮点数或小数。

    3.2K21

    hive sql(六)—— 每个用户连续登录最大天数

    )t1 )t2 group by t2.id,t2.rq1 -- 第二次分组 )t3 group by t3.id -- 第三次分组 ; 结果...,所以时间信息,并按照升序,需要在窗口里面添加order by 3、核心逻辑——连续登录判断是,通过排序添加序号,再用当前日期和当前序号做差, 如果得到日期相同,则表示是连续日期,所以使用row_number..., 4、整体逻辑顺序是先排序添加序号字段、计算差值日期、统计差值日期相同数量、最后得出每个用户差值日期数最多即需求 扩展 1、这里t1,t2可以合并为一步,减少一次子查询 2、第一次分组是每个用户每天只有一条数据...,第二次分组是统计差值日期相同数量,第三次分组是统计每个用户最大连续登录天数 知识点 1、row_number添加序号,无论字段值是否相同 2、date_sub(日期,数值),用日期-数值,即当前日期前...n天,返回值是日期字符串类型 分析中第3点在hive sql系列(三)中计算连续日活中也用到了日期差值,参考链接: hive sql(三)—— 求所有用户和活跃用户总数及平均年龄

    2.9K40

    数据分析之数据处理

    数据处理包括数据清洗、数据抽取、数据合并、数据计算、数据分组等操作。在进行数据处理之前,先要了解数据变量。 ?...3.日期型数据 日期型数据用于表示日期或时间数据,它可以进行算术运算,所以它是特殊数值型数据。日期型数据主要应用在时间序列分析中。...记录合并,也称为纵向合并,是将具有共同数据字段、结构,不同数据表记录信息,合并到一个新数据表中。...其中,用于绘制分布图X轴分组变量,是不能改变其顺序,一般按分组区间从小到大进行排列,这样才能观察数据分布规律。在SPSS里可使用可视分箱进行数据分组。 对于不等距操作,可以重新编码为不同变量。...重新编码可以把一个变量数值按照指定要求赋予新数值,也可以把连续变量重新编码成离散变量,如把年龄重新编码为年龄段。 数据标准化 数据标准化是将数据按比例缩放,使之落在一个特定区间。

    2.2K20

    hive sql和mysql区别_mysql改表名语句

    6 mssql识别符是[],[type]表示他区别于关键字,但是mysql却是 `,也就是按键1左边那个符号 7 mssql支持getdate()方法获取当前时间日期,但是mysql里面可以分日期类型和时间类型...,获取当前日期是cur_date(),当前完整时间是 now()函数 8 mssql不支持replace into 语句,但是在最新sql20008里面,也支持merge语法 9 mysql支持insert...20一个很表面的区别就是mysql安装特别简单,而且文件大小才110M(非安装版),相比微软这个庞然大物,安装进度来说简直就是….. 21mysql管理工具有几个比较好,mysql_front,...24php连接mysql和mssql方式都差不多,只需要将函数mysql替换成mssql即可。...25mysql支持date,time,year类型,mssql2008才支持date和time。 版权声明:本文内容由互联网用户自发贡献,该文观点仅代表作者本人。

    3.8K10

    Oracle数据库之操作符及函数

    (在mysql中是另外联合查询--不是一个表) ③、minus:返回从第一个查询结果中排除第二个查询中出现行;(在第一个结果中查找不满足第二个) 6、连接操作符:     将多个字符串或数据值合并成一个字符串...二、SQL函数:     用于执行特殊操作函数; 1、分类:   单行、 分组、分析; 2、单行函数分类:   从表中查询每一行只返回一个值;   字符、数字、日期、转换、其他; 3、字符函数:...,返回指定日期模式截断后第一天; next_day(d,day):下周周几日期 extract:计算年份差: --日期函数 select add_months(sbirth,-3)  from java0322...,不论值是否相等; rank:具有相等值行排位相同,序数随后跳跃; dense_rank:具有相等值行排位相同,序号是连续 -- 排位 select empno,ename,job,sal,row_number...()over (order by sal desc) as  numm from emp; --相等值行排位相同,序号是连续;12234

    1.2K20

    等保测评2.0:SQLServer安全审计

    至于具体如何实现其中规则,这里我就不详细写了,网上写得很清楚:SQLSERVER2008新增审核/审计功能 (之所不写是因为大部分情况下被测评方要么就没有采取任何措施,要么就使用数据库审计系统来实现了...,通过数据库本身功能来实现概率很小) 哦,对了,这是SQLServer2008和之后版本才具备功能,在之前版本中,实现相关功能方法有: ?...四、测评项b b)审计记录应包括事件日期和时间、用户、事件类型、事件是否成功及其他与审计相关信息; 这里是指至少应该包括最关键数据,也就是日期和时间、用户、事件类型、事件是否成功及其他与审计相关信息...而执行sp_cycle_errorlog该命令权限,仅服务器角色sysadmin才具有。 如果从操作系统层面来说的话,也就是错误日志文件权限: ?...如果是默认错误日志,是存放在文件中,其存储路径为:C:\Program Files (x86)\Microsoft SQL Server\MSSQL.1\MSSQL\LOG。

    3.4K20

    POSTGRESQL PG VS SQL SERVER 到底哪家强? (译) 应该是目前最全面的比较

    它可以在具有 Kubernetes 支持 Linux 操作系统上运行,也可以在 Windows 系统上运行。用户描述它易于使用和可靠,具有强大 .NET 兼容性。...MSSQL 中文:两个数据库trigger比较 PostgreSQL具有高级触发器。...MSSQL 中文:分区在两种数据库不同 PostgreSQL PostgreSQL内置支持范围、列表和哈希分区。范围分区将表分组为由分区键列或一组列定义范围,例如按日期范围。...SQL Server包含对内存中优化表磁盘存储扩展性增强。当前版本提供了多个并发线程以保存内存中优化表,多线程恢复和合并操作,以及动态管理视图。...MSSQL 中文:两种数据库在MVCC 数据一致性上不同 PostgreSQL具有成熟多版本并发控制(MVCC)系统来处理同时进行多个过程。

    2.1K20

    Pandas库常用方法、函数集合

    合并多个dataframe,类似sql中union pivot:按照指定行列重塑表格 pivot_table:数据透视表,类似excel中透视表 cut:将一组数据分割成离散区间,适合将数值进行分类...:绘制平行坐标图,用于展示具有多个特征数据集中各个样本之间关系 pandas.plotting.scatter_matrix:绘制散点矩阵图 pandas.plotting.table:绘制表格形式可视化图...日期时间 to_datetime: 将输入转换为Datetime类型 date_range: 生成日期范围 to_timedelta: 将输入转换为Timedelta类型 timedelta_range...: 生成时间间隔范围 shift: 沿着时间轴将数据移动 resample: 对时间序列进行重新采样 asfreq: 将时间序列转换为指定频率 cut: 将连续数据划分为离散箱 period_range...: 获取日期星期几和月份名称 total_seconds: 计算时间间隔总秒数 rolling: 用于滚动窗口操作 expanding: 用于展开窗口操作 at_time, between_time

    26710

    数据仓库系列--维度表技术

    此时事实数据需要关联特定维度,这些特定维度包含在从细节维度选择行中,所以叫维度子集。 细节维度和维度子集具有相同属性或内容,具有一致性。 1.建立包含属性子集子维度 比如需要上钻到子维度。...例如,事实表可以有多个日期,每个日期通过外键引用不同日期维度,原则上每个外键表示不同维度视图,这样引用具有不同含义。...层次关系方法:固定深度层次进行分组和钻取查询,递归层次结构数据装载、展开与平面化,多路径层次和参差不齐处理 五.退化维度 除了业务主键外没有其他内容维度表。...六.杂项维度 包含数据具有很少可能值维度。有时与其为每个标志或属性定义不同维度,不如建立单独讲不同维度合并到一起杂项维度。...七.维度合并 如果几个相关维度基数都很小,或者具有多个公共属性时,可以考虑合并。 八.分段维度 包含连续分段度量值,通常用作客户维度行为标记时间序列,分析客户行为。

    15110

    先弄懂SPSS基础知识吧

    日期常量:日期个数数据,一般需要使用日期函数进行转换; 2 变量 变量名长度不能超过8; 三种基本类型:数值、字符和日期; 可以在variable view界面设定变量长度及小数位、变量描述...字符型变量使用auto recode 8 Split file 有的时候需要对变量做些分组分析,但一些分析方法并不提供分组变量设置选项这就需要用到Split file命令; 例如使用 Descriptives...做描述性分析,如果想分年龄做分析,这样就可以用年龄变量做为分组变量; 可以看到这里Split其实是分组,而不是拆分文件; 9 Merge File add cases 合并变量相同,但是case不同文件...; add variables合并变量不同,case相同文件这里变量不同可以是部分变量不同,case相同也可以是一个文件case是另外一个文件子集; 10 数据分类汇总 使用Aggregate...; 6 分类变量统计描述常用指标 7 Spss操作 8 连续变量描述指标 9 如何计算各个描述统计量

    3.9K101
    领券